For Shane Ross-Sony EX-1 XDCAM with Xpress
by
Bill Megalos
on Jun 5, 2008 at 2:35:10 am
Shane,
I've been working on a documentary for 6 months, shooting on the Sony Z1, HDV 60i, 1440x1080, 25mbs. The footage is fine, but the camera is not very sensitive and bad in low light. I recently bought and have been using the Sony EX-1 very happily and successfully with FCP and want to use it on an important shoot coming up Friday. I need to leave tomorrow for Boston (I'm in LA) and our New York editor has been unable to import the files from the EX-1 that I've sent her (she's using Xpress Pro) I tried Bob Russo's tutorial to create MXF files for the Avid (http://community.avid.com/blogs/training/archive/2008/01/28/sony-xdcam-ex-with-the-avid-media-composer.aspx) but XDCAM Clip Browser only exports in its PC version, it seems, not in the Mac version. I tried using XDCAM Transfer software, creating Quicktimes, which work in FCP, but the AVID does not play that audio. I'm stumped, I'd like to use this camera, but can't afford to shoot the next week's events and not be able to use them. Help, please, need an answer tonight, so I know which camera to pack.
Thank you, Bill Megalos
